Called 'Presa' in Spanish, the 2-inch thick cut from the shoulder/collar area has off-the-charts marbling, equivalent to its beef counterpart, the Denver steak.
Campo Grande's Bellota Iberico pork is the perfect example of attention to genetics, lifestyle and diet, creating incredibly marbled cuts. Sourced directly from humane family-owned farms in southern Spain that never use antibiotics or hormones.
These rustic slow growth black-hoofed hogs are free-range and live twice as long as their industrial counterparts. Their 100% vegetarian diet hinges on nuts and grasses which creates a multilayered flavor and off-the-charts marbling. The Wagyu of pork!
Sustainably raised. No Antibiotics. No hormones. Non-GMO.
